HEARING REVIEWS: November 17, 2003

Ramapo Catskill Library System (side yard)

Dan Yanosh: This is an existing 1 story building on 17m and they propose a 10x24 addition for storage for a computer room. It has been there since 1961 and they have 3 parcels.

Mr. Smith: Is it a 2 story building as well?

Mr. Yanosh: Yes. We’re here for a variance for the side yard from 20ft to 7.5 feet. The need is for a computer room and have been there for 15 years with the expansion for paper and equipment storage.

Library representative: There are 47 member libraries in several counties and we purchase computers and install them and they come in in large lots and need place to store then and the WAN (wide area network) is located in that location and manage over 800 computers and repair computers and have staff of 7. When we started had 0 technicians and now 7 and 17 libraries in Orange County alone.

Mr. Smith: this will be enough?

Mr. Yanosh: No.

Mrs. Thompson: access in/out is adequate?

Library representative: We were in for an addition in 1984 but it was closer to the property. We have full staff of 28 in the building.

Mr. Oster: This ‘L’ shape was added. You are going to nudge the neighbor again?

Library representative: We have good relationship with them. No other location.

Mr. Oster: There is not 284 square feet inside to accommodate this?

Library representative: No.

Mr. Oster: Take a look and have a hearing.

Mr. Smith: What about the other building?

Library representative: It is for rough storage and we will take it down at some time in the future. We are open Monday through Friday from 8a to 9p with 4-9 staff and only 1 or 2 people on the weekend.

Mr. Smith: I Move to hold a Public Hearing on November 17, 2003 at 7:30pm or as soon thereafter as the matter can be heard; Seconded; All in favor; Motion carried.


Mr. Smith: It is necessary to notify everyone within 300 feet of the property. You can obtain the list of names from the Tax Office. The notice of the Public Hearing will be in the Times Herald Record’s public notice section within the next week. Take that notice, copy it and mail it to everyone at least 10 days prior to your scheduled Public Hearing date. Mailings must be sent by certified or registered mail. Bring the proof of mailings with you to your Public Hearing. The Public Hearing can’t be opened without your proof of mailings.
